Gain settings
The gain in the application depends mainly on:
the sensitivity of the microphone,
the distance to the microphone,
the audio level of the sound,
the desired output level.
The sensitivity of the microphone is generally expressed in dB/Pa, referenced to 1 V/Pa. For
example, the microphone used in testing had an output voltage of 6.3 mV for a sound
pressure of 1 Pa (where Pa is the pressure unit, Pascal). Expressed in dB, the sensitivity is:
20Log(0.0063) = -44 dB/Pa
To facilitate the first approach, Table 10 gives voltages and gains used with a low-cost omni-
directional electret condenser microphone of -44 dB/Pa.
The gain of the TS472 microphone preamplifier can be set as follows.
1.
From -1.5 dB to 41 dB by connecting an external grounded resistor RGS to the GS pin.
This enables the gain to be adapted more precisely to each application.
2.
To 20 dB by applying VGS > 1VDC on the gain select (GS) pin. This setting can help to
reduce a number of external components in an application, because 2.0 VDC is
provided by the TS472 itself on the BIAS pin.
